Specifications
Frequency Stability: --
Current - Supply (Disable) (Max): 3.7mA
Height: 0.047" (1.20mm)
Size / Dimension: 0.126" L x 0.098" W (3.20mm x 2.50mm)
Package / Case: 4-SMD, No Lead
Mounting Type: Surface Mount
Ratings: --
Current - Supply (Max): --
Spread Spectrum Bandwidth: -0.50%, Down Spread
Operating Temperature: -40°C ~ 85°C
Frequency Stability (Total): --
Series: SG-9101
Voltage - Supply: 1.62 V ~ 3.63 V
Output: CMOS
Function: Enable/Disable
Available Frequency Range: 670kHz ~ 170MHz
Programmable Type: Programmed by Digi-Key (Enter your frequency in Web Order Notes)
Type: XO (Standard)
Base Resonator: Crystal
Part Status: Active
Packaging: Tube
